Quectel Wireless Solutions (SHSE:603236)

Simply Wall St Growth Rating: ★★★★★☆

Overview: Quectel Wireless Solutions Co., Ltd. is a global company specializing in the research, development, design, production, and sales of wireless communication modules and solutions, with a market capitalization of approximately CN¥13.37 billion.

Operations: The company generates its revenue primarily from the design, production, and sales of wireless communication modules and solutions globally.

Insider Ownership: 24.4%

Earnings Growth Forecast: 37.8% p.a.

Quectel Wireless Solutions, a key player in the IoT sector, has shown substantial growth with its innovative product launches like the FLM263D Wi-Fi module enhancing smart home connectivity. Despite a challenging market, Quectel's recent earnings report indicates robust recovery with significant revenue and net income improvements. High insider ownership aligns management with shareholder interests, although its forecasted Return on Equity suggests modest future profitability relative to other investments. The firm is trading below its estimated fair value, suggesting potential undervaluation in a growing market.

Hangzhou Changchuan TechnologyLtd (SZSE:300604)

Simply Wall St Growth Rating: ★★★★★★

Overview: Hangzhou Changchuan Technology Co., Ltd. focuses on researching, developing, producing, and selling integrated circuit equipment and high-frequency communication materials, with a market capitalization of approximately CN¥20.06 billion.

Operations: The company generates its revenue from the sale of integrated circuit equipment and high-frequency communication materials.

Insider Ownership: 28.4%

Earnings Growth Forecast: 55.3% p.a.

Hangzhou Changchuan Technology Co., Ltd, a Chinese growth company with substantial insider ownership, recently affirmed its dividend and reported a significant turnaround in quarterly earnings from a loss last year to profits this year. Despite challenges like shareholder dilution and lower profit margins compared to the previous year, the company is poised for robust revenue and earnings growth over the next three years. Recent board changes could influence future governance and strategic direction, aligning with long-term growth objectives.

SG Micro (SZSE:300661)

Simply Wall St Growth Rating: ★★★★★☆

Overview: SG Micro Corp, specializing in the design, marketing, and sale of analog integrated circuits primarily in China, has a market capitalization of approximately CN¥36.86 billion.

Operations: The company generates CN¥2.83 billion in revenue from its integrated circuit industry segment.

Insider Ownership: 32.8%

Earnings Growth Forecast: 41.3% p.a.

SG Micro, a Chinese growth company, is experiencing substantial earnings growth, forecasted at 41.28% annually. However, its profit margins have declined from 22% to 10.8%. Despite this drop, revenue growth is robust at 20.7% yearly, outpacing the national market average of 13.7%. Recent corporate actions include consistent dividend payments and significant changes in governance aimed at bolstering long-term strategies. These factors indicate a focused but challenging path ahead for SG Micro in leveraging insider ownership for growth.
